+# frozen_string_literal: true
+
+require 'spec_helper'
+require_migration!
+
+RSpec.describe MoveSecurityFindingsTableToGitlabPartitionsDynamicSchema do
+ let(:partitions_sql) do
+ <<~SQL
+ SELECT
+ partitions.relname AS partition_name
+ FROM pg_inherits
+ JOIN pg_class parent ON pg_inherits.inhparent = parent.oid
+ JOIN pg_class partitions ON pg_inherits.inhrelid = partitions.oid
+ WHERE
+ parent.relname = 'security_findings'
+ SQL
+ end
+
+ describe '#up' do
+ it 'changes the `security_findings` table to be partitioned' do
+ expect { migrate! }.to change { security_findings_partitioned? }.from(false).to(true)
+ .and change { execute(partitions_sql) }.from([]).to(['security_findings_1'])
+ end
+ end
+
+ describe '#down' do
+ context 'when there is a partition' do
+ let(:users) { table(:users) }
+ let(:namespaces) { table(:namespaces) }
+ let(:projects) { table(:projects) }
+ let(:scanners) { table(:vulnerability_scanners) }
+ let(:security_scans) { table(:security_scans) }
+ let(:security_findings) { table(:security_findings) }
+
+ let(:user) { users.create!(email: 'test@gitlab.com', projects_limit: 5) }
+ let(:namespace) { namespaces.create!(name: 'gtlb', path: 'gitlab', type: Namespaces::UserNamespace.sti_name) }
+ let(:project) { projects.create!(namespace_id: namespace.id, project_namespace_id: namespace.id, name: 'foo') }
+ let(:scanner) { scanners.create!(project_id: project.id, external_id: 'bandit', name: 'Bandit') }
+ let(:security_scan) { security_scans.create!(build_id: 1, scan_type: 1) }
+
+ let(:security_findings_count_sql) { 'SELECT COUNT(*) FROM security_findings' }
+
+ before do
+ migrate!
+
+ security_findings.create!(
+ scan_id: security_scan.id,
+ scanner_id: scanner.id,
+ uuid: SecureRandom.uuid,
+ severity: 0,
+ confidence: 0
+ )
+ end
+
+ it 'creates the original table with the data from the existing partition' do
+ expect { schema_migrate_down! }.to change { security_findings_partitioned? }.from(true).to(false)
+ .and not_change { execute(security_findings_count_sql) }.from([1])
+ end
+
+ context 'when there are more than one partitions' do
+ before do
+ migrate!
+
+ execute(<<~SQL)
+ CREATE TABLE gitlab_partitions_dynamic.security_findings_11
+ PARTITION OF security_findings FOR VALUES IN (11)
+ SQL
+ end
+
+ it 'creates the original table from the latest existing partition' do
+ expect { schema_migrate_down! }.to change { security_findings_partitioned? }.from(true).to(false)
+ .and change { execute(security_findings_count_sql) }.from([1]).to([0])
+ end
+ end
+ end
+
+ context 'when there is no partition' do
+ before do
+ migrate!
+
+ execute(partitions_sql).each do |partition_name|
+ execute("DROP TABLE gitlab_partitions_dynamic.#{partition_name}")
+ end
+ end
+
+ it 'creates the original table' do
+ expect { schema_migrate_down! }.to change { security_findings_partitioned? }.from(true).to(false)
+ end
+ end
+ end
+
+ def security_findings_partitioned?
+ sql = <<~SQL
+ SELECT
+ COUNT(*)
+ FROM
+ pg_partitioned_table
+ INNER JOIN pg_class ON pg_class.oid = pg_partitioned_table.partrelid
+ WHERE pg_class.relname = 'security_findings'
+ SQL
+
+ execute(sql).first != 0
+ end
+
+ def execute(sql)
+ ActiveRecord::Base.connection.execute(sql).values.flatten
+ end
+end
